**Introduction to the PDTC144ET Electronic Component**  

The PDTC144ET is a versatile NPN digital transistor designed for switching and amplification applications in electronic circuits. This component integrates a bias resistor network, simplifying circuit design by reducing the need for external resistors. With built-in resistors connected to the base and emitter, the PDTC144ET offers improved noise immunity and stable performance in low-power applications.  

Featuring a compact SOT-23 surface-mount package, the PDTC144ET is ideal for space-constrained designs, such as portable electronics, IoT devices, and signal processing circuits. Its low saturation voltage and high current gain make it suitable for driving small loads, logic level shifting, and interfacing between microcontrollers and other components.  

Key specifications include a collector current rating of 100mA and a voltage rating of 50V, ensuring reliable operation in various low-voltage environments. The integrated resistors enhance design efficiency while maintaining consistent performance across temperature variations.  

Engineers and hobbyists alike benefit from the PDTC144ET’s ease of use and reliability, making it a practical choice for digital switching and general-purpose amplification tasks. Its standardized footprint ensures compatibility with automated assembly processes, further streamlining production workflows.
